DIGITAL VIDEO AND IMAGERY DISTRIBUTION SYSTEM (DVIDS) Satellite Communication (SATCOM) New Systems Acquisition and Incidental Services Requirement for the US Army Forces Central Command (USARCENT). Description: The Mission & Installation Contacting Command Center - Fort McPherson (MICCC-FM), Fort McPherson, Georgia is hosting an Industry day to inform industry leaders about the Digital Video and Imagery Distribution System (DVIDS) Satellite Communication (SATCOM) terminal systems requirement for the US Army Central (USARCENT). An Industry Day will be held on Thursday, November 13th beginning at 0900 hours in the MICCC-FM conference room, located on the Ground Floor Howell Hall section of Building 131, Fort McPherson, Georgia. Brief Description of Requirement: US Army Central (USARCENT) has a requirement to acquire new Digital Video and Imagery Distribution System (DVIDS) Satellite Communication (SATCOM) terminal systems and procure services to support legacy and new systerms. Requirement is to procure approximately 300+ new SATCOM terminal systems and porvide incidental services in these functional areas: 1) fielding (i.e. manufacture/purchase and ship) new DVIDS compatible SATCOM terminal systems, 2) providing scheduled and unscheduled maintenance support service to users of legacy (currently in service) and new DVIDS compatible SATCOM terminal systems to include annual scheduled/preventive maintenance inspections, 3) staffing and maintaining a 24/7 technical helpdesk support center, 4) developing and/or conducting user field-level operations and maintenance training (stateside and overseas) for legacy and new DVIDS compatible SATCOM terminal systems, and 5) obtaining and delivering spares and parts to facilitate user/regional operator level maintenance and contractor facilitated repairs. The current SATCOM terminal systems and the newly acquired systems under this requirement are and will be part of the Digital Video and Imagery Distribution System (DVIDS), a program currently under the direction of USARCENT. These SATCOM terminal systems are and will be used to send interviews, imagery, and video footage and print stories, etc. to a centrally located hub. Currently fielded DVIDS SATCOM terminals are in three (3) configurations DVIDS Type A (~1m antenna) - Deployable, DVIDS Type B (~2.4m antenna) - Transportable, and DVIDS Type C - Man-packable. A potential requirement for two (2) additional configurations exists which will be called DVIDS Type D (~1.6m antenna) - Vehicle (HMVV) Mounted and a DVIDS Type E Maritime version. There are approximately 130 legacy terminals currently fielded in various configurations of the Norsat Newslink (DVIDS Type A/B) and Norsat Globetrekker (DVIDS Type C) systems manufactured by Norsat International (America), Inc. These NORSAT systems are a part of the legacy systems that must also be maintained with the new satellite systems purchased under this requirement. New (future) systems procured may be brand name or equal.
